Προγραμματισμός

* Γνώση Υπολογιστών >> Προγραμματισμός >> C /C + + Προγραμματισμός

Πώς να χρησιμοποιήσετε Υπερφόρτωση σε C + +

Υπερφόρτωση τελεστών είναι βολικό σε C + + όταν χρησιμοποιείται object-oriented προγραμματισμό . Είναι που χρησιμοποιούνται σε C + + μαθήματα όποτε πρέπει να οριστούν οι ειδικές λειτουργικότητα σε υπάρχοντα C + + πρωτόγονες φορείς . Για παράδειγμα, το "+" φορέας χρησιμοποιείται για να προσθέσει ακέραιοι σε C + + . Η έκφραση " 2 +2 " θα επιστρέψει ο ακέραιος 4 . Οδηγίες
Η 1

Καθορίστε ποιες οι φορείς εκμετάλλευσης οφείλουν να υπερφορτωθεί στο C + + class . Να με θυμάσαι σε C + + , ο χρήστης μπορεί να επιβαρύνει τη συμπεριφορά του κάθε φορέα . Οι πιο κοινές υπερφορτωμένα φορείς είναι : " >> " , " + " και " - " 2

Ορίστε το φορέα που σκοπεύετε να επιβαρύνει στον ορισμό κλάσης σας . . Η C + + σύνταξη είναι η εξής : φορέας ( parameter. .. ) ?
Εικόνων 3

Γράψτε υπερφορτωμένη συνάρτηση-μέλος την τάξη σας . Αυτό θα μπορούσε να είναι λίγο δύσκολο , ανάλογα με το τι προσπαθούμε να κάνουμε . Να είστε σίγουροι ότι η συνάρτηση-μέλος σας παρέχει τη λειτουργικότητα που απαιτεί την τάξη σας .
Η 4

Δοκιμάστε νέα λειτουργία του δικτύου σας . Στο ελάχιστο , να δημιουργήσετε ένα νέο αντικείμενο και να επικαλεσθεί τη νέα υπερφορτωμένο φορέα . Είναι πάντα μια καλή ιδέα να δοκιμάσετε νέες λειτουργίες σας πολύ καλά . Καλύτερα αποτελέσματα δοκιμών σε καλύτερα προϊόντα .
5

Ενσωματώστε την τάξη σε C + + σας αρχική λογισμικού . Εάν υπάρχουν πολλές προγραμματιστές που εργάζονται για το έργο , παρέχουν επαρκή τεκμηρίωση για τα νέα υπερφόρτωση του δικτύου σας . Επίσης , παρέχουν ένα παράδειγμα για να διευκρινίσει τη συμπεριφορά .
Η
εικόνων

Συναφής σύστασή

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α